Quality/Engineering Manager

About PURIS:

PURIS operates across North America as the largest independent trenchless rehabilitation provider with 900+ employees dedicated to building lasting infrastructure with smart, sustainable resource management. The PURIS Family of Companies provide trenchless renewal solutions in the water, wastewater, and stormwater markets. Our environmentally friendly solutions work within the existing infrastructure to save time, minimize environmental impact, and cause fewer community disruptions. With an unrivaled toolbox of technologies, PURIS has the RIGHT solution for each project.

Opportunity:

PURIS is experiencing aggressive growth through integration of the businesses and recognizes a need to continuously strengthen and standardize its operational capabilities to meet increased demand and increase customer satisfaction. We are looking for a Quality/Engineering Manager to lead our Project Management and Operations Teams in optimizing and executing our Quality Management System (QMS) for customer excellence.

PURIS’ QMS is critical to the success of our company and the Quality team is responsible for QMS management. This includes the consolidation of Cost of Poor Quality (COPQ) Metrics, developing standard operating procedures (SOPs), and assuring adherence to the ISO 9001 standard along with any applicable regulatory requirements. These key functions are in addition to supporting our Project Management and Operations teams through the manufacturing and installation processes in the field along with continuous improvement activities.

Job Summary Description:

The Quality/Engineering Manager will be responsible for supporting the QMS through the consolidation and communication of critical metrics such as COPQ along with any root cause analysis date. Core functions also include coordinating with the Leadership team in standardized SOP/standard work development, process mapping of current and future states, creating visual management boards that are based upon lean manufacturing principles. Another key function is to facilitate corrective actions when applicable and support the region on customer quality issues.

Essential Job Accountabilities:

  • COPQ metric consolidation and analyzation Work with the Regions to gather COPQ metrics on a daily basis for issues occurring in the manufacturing facility or in the field. This will require consistent communication and follow-up with the Regions and may require coaching, training and mentoring of the teams on proper submission and completion of metrics. In addition, the data will need to be compiled, analyzed, and placed into pareto charts to identify the areas of focus for corrective action and continuous improvement activities.
  • Lead the Project Management Team Develop templates for standard work submittals for customers including, but not limited to plans, designs, schedules and billing.
  • Manage the corrective action process Work with Regions and cross functional personnel to facilitate robust root cause analysis and countermeasures. Any key data points found, with corresponding corrective actions, will be communicated to the appropriate Leadership teams and disseminated to all Regions as part of standardization to ensure prevention of a similar failure mode.
  • Standard operating procedure development Work with the Leadership at a Functional and Regional level to develop SOPs and best practices that can be implemented across the Operations and Project Management team for optimization.
  • Day to day management of quality and project activities as needed including any additional key performance indicator (KPI) data on critical to quality (CTQ) processes, customer requirements and training of appropriate personnel in data identification as applicable.
  • Involvement with suppliers, when applicable, on quality or customer-related failure modes to ensure robust corrective measures have been implemented. This may also include supporting the audits of critical vendors.
